Find Out the Difference Between RFID and QR Code

As newer technologies enter the picture, both RFID and QR codes have managed to stay prevalent in the global business landscape. The 21st century has seen a rise in innovative security solutions. Irrespective of your business type, you should understand the solutions that will help you streamline your operations and save you considerable time and effort. 

This article will give a comprehensive analysis and the difference between RFID and QR codes. We will also cover the basics and which technology is better suited for your business. 

Let’s dive straight into the basics of both RFID and QR codes. 

difference between RFID and QR code

What is RFID? 

Before understanding the difference between RFID and QR codes, be clear on the basics of both. RFID is a technology that uses electromagnetic fields to identify and track tags attached to objects. These tags contain electronically stored information that can be remotely retrieved using RFID readers or scanners. 

Commonly used in logistics, inventory management, and access control systems, RFID offers real-time tracking and data collection capabilities.

What is a QR code and how does it work?

On the other hand, QR codes are two-dimensional barcodes that store information in a matrix pattern. These codes can be scanned using a smartphone or dedicated QR code reader, providing quick access to information, websites, or multimedia content. QR codes have found widespread use in marketing, product labeling, and contactless payments. 

The working mechanism of Quick Response codes is based on a simple yet effective principle of encoding and decoding information. QR codes are two-dimensional barcodes that consist of black squares arranged on a white square grid. The information encoded in a QR code can include alphanumeric characters, binary data, or even Kanji characters. The key elements of the code are as follows:

1. Encoding Information:

A. Data Modules:

A QR code comprises data modules arranged in a square grid. The number of modules determines the capacity of the QR code to store information.

B. Error Correction:

  • QR codes often incorporate error correction mechanisms. Error correction allows the QR code to still be scanned successfully even if parts of it are damaged or obscured. There are four levels of error correction: L (Low), M (Medium), Q (Quartile), and H (High).

C. Data Types:

  • QR codes can encode various data types, including numeric, alphanumeric, binary, and Kanji characters. The type of data influences the capacity of the QR code to store information.

2. Structured Format:

A. Finder Patterns:

  • To assist with the quick identification and orientation of the QR code, finder patterns are placed at three corners. These are distinct square patterns that act as reference points for scanners.

B. Alignment Patterns:

  • Alignment patterns are smaller square patterns that enhance the accuracy of scanning. They allow the scanner to adjust for distortion and perspective.

C. Timing Patterns:

  • Timing patterns are horizontal and vertical lines of alternating black and white modules. These patterns help the scanner determine the size and resolution of the QR code.

3. Quiet Zone:

  • A quiet zone is a margin of white space surrounding the QR code. This space is essential to prevent interference from other visual elements, ensuring accurate scanning.

4. Decoding Process:

A. Scanning:

  • When a user or a device scans a QR code using a camera or a dedicated QR code reader, the software captures an image of the QR code.

B. Recognition and Alignment:

  • The software identifies the finder patterns and alignment patterns, allowing it to understand the structure and orientation of the QR code.

C. Data Extraction:

  • The software decodes the data modules by interpreting the black-and-white patterns. The encoded information is then extracted.

D. Error Correction:

  • If error correction is incorporated, the software uses redundant information to correct any errors that may have occurred during scanning.

5. Action:

  • After successful decoding, the QR code software takes appropriate action based on the type of information encoded. This action could include opening a website, displaying text, initiating a payment, or any other predefined function.

6. Dynamic QR Codes:

  • Some QR codes are dynamic, meaning the encoded information can be changed even after the QR code is generated. This allows for greater flexibility, especially in marketing and advertising applications.

Now, that you are clear about both technologies, let’s jump straight to the difference between RFID and QR codes. 

RFID vs. QR Code

The major differentiating factor lies in the way the technologies operate. Here is a complete difference between RFID and QR codes. 

FactorRFID QR code
Technology/MechanismUses radio-frequency signals for communication between the tag and reader.Relies on optical scanning using a camera or QR code reader.
Range/DistanceOperates over a longer range; tags can be read from several feet away.Requires close proximity for successful scanning; typically a few inches to a foot.
Data CapacityStores a relatively smaller amount of data.Can store various data types including text, URLs, and images, offering higher versatility.
Suitability for BusinessExcellent for logistics and inventory management, providing real-time tracking over large areas.Ideal for marketing and customer engagement, offering quick access to information or promotions.
Cost-effectivenessImplementation costs may be higher due to the need for specialized RFID readers.Generally more cost-effective, making it suitable for small businesses with budget constraints.
Use CasesCommonly used in supply chain management, access control, and asset tracking.Widely used in advertising, product labeling, and contactless payments.
Future ScopeAdvancing with smaller, cost-effective tags and increased integration with IoT.Evolving with innovations in design, functionality, and embedded security features.
Security ConcernsSusceptible to unauthorized scanning, requiring robust security measures.Prone to hacking or phishing attacks; necessitates encryption and secure practices.
Environmental ImpactMay involve physical tags, potentially contributing to waste.Generally considered more environmentally friendly as they can be displayed digitally or printed on packaging.

Difference between RFID and QR Code – Which is Suitable for You?

RFID (Radio-Frequency Identification):

Pros:

I) Real-Time Tracking: RFID excels in scenarios where real-time tracking of assets, products, or inventory is crucial. It provides continuous monitoring without the need for a direct line of sight.

II) Longer Reading Range: RFID tags can be read from a distance, making them efficient for applications such as logistics and supply chain management.

III) Automation: RFID enables automation in various processes, reducing manual efforts and increasing operational efficiency.

Cons:

I) Cost: Implementation costs for RFID systems can be higher due to the need for specialized RFID readers and tags.

II) Data Capacity: RFID typically stores a smaller amount of data compared to QR codes, limiting its versatility in certain applications.

Best Suited For

Logistics and Supply Chain: RFID is ideal for tracking the movement of goods in a warehouse or along a supply chain.

Access Control: RFID is commonly used for access control systems in offices, buildings, and events.

QR Codes (Quick Response Codes):

Pros:

I) Cost-Effective: QR codes are generally more cost-effective to implement. They can be generated and printed easily, and users can scan them using smartphones.

II) Versatility: QR codes can store a variety of data types, including text, URLs, and images, making them versatile for marketing and informational purposes.

III) Easy Adoption: With the ubiquity of smartphones, users find QR codes easy to scan, facilitating quick access to information.

Cons:

I) Shorter Reading Range: QR codes require close proximity for scanning, limiting their use in scenarios where longer reading ranges are essential.

II) Dependence on Visual Scanning: QR codes depend on visual scanning, which may not be suitable for environments with poor lighting or damaged codes.

Best Suited For

Marketing and Advertising: QR codes are effective for engaging customers with promotions, advertisements, and product information.

Contactless Payments: QR codes are increasingly used for mobile payments, providing a convenient and secure method.

Choosing the Right Technology for Your Business:

1) Consider Your Use Case: Evaluate the specific needs of your business. If real-time tracking and automation are paramount, RFID might be more suitable. For marketing and customer engagement, QR codes could be the better choice.

2) Budget Constraints: Consider your budget. QR codes are generally more cost-effective to implement, making them accessible for small businesses.

3) Operational Environment: Assess the operational environment. If your business operates in a large warehouse or outdoor setting where longer reading ranges are essential, RFID might be more practical.

4) Future Scalability: Consider the future scalability of your chosen technology. RFID is evolving with IoT integration, while QR codes are advancing with innovations in design and functionality.

5) User Experience: Think about the user experience. QR codes are user-friendly, especially with the widespread use of smartphones, making them easily adaptable by consumers.

Next, let’s check the frequently asked questions on the difference between RFID and QR codes.

FAQs – The Difference Between RFID and QR Code

What are the advantages of QR codes over RFID?

You cannot deny the importance of RFID tags as they have greater range and functionality. However. QR codes are easy to implement, and use, and a lot cheaper than RFID technology. 

Which is better RFID or QR code?

It mainly depends on your specific needs. However, QR codes are practical as they are easy to use and you can print them whenever you want. 

What is the purpose of RFID?

The main purpose of RFID is to identify the tagged objects and keep track of their position along the supply chain operations. 

What is better than QR?

The best alternatives to QR codes can be NFC tags. The advanced encryption technology makes them suitable for use in contactless mobile payments and other sensitive applications. 

Conclusion

Both RFID and QR technology offer superior speed, accuracy, and efficiency. Gauging the difference between RFID and QR codes will enable you to make a well-informed decision regarding security solutions. 

If you are interested in learning about various security technologies, feel free to get in touch with Qodenext for a hassle-free experience. 

Also read: RFID vs. IoT: A Comprehensive Guide.